  • Research progress of artificial intelligence convolutional neural network in whole slide image analysis

    Histopathology is still the golden standard for the diagnosis of clinical diseases. Whole slide image (WSI) can make up for the shortcomings of traditional glass slices, such as easy damage, difficult retrieval and poor diagnostic repeatability, but it also brings huge workload. Artificial intelligence (AI) assisted pathologist's WSI analysis can solve the problem of low efficiency and improve the consistency of diagnosis. Among them, the convolution neural network (CNN) algorithm is the most widely used. This article aims to review the reported application of CNN in WSI image analysis, summarizes the development trend of CNN in the field of pathology and makes a prospect.

  • Application standard of mechanical suture technique in thoracoscopic surgery and management of complications

    The precise resection and suture of bronchia, vascular and pulmonary tissue are the key techniques in thoracic surgery. Mechanical suture technique has gradually become a routine operation in thoracic surgery. However, at present, there is still a lack of consensus and guidelines on the application of this technique in thoracic surgery, neither strong evidence-based medical support. In this study, we discuss the application standard of mechanical suture technique in thoracoscopic surgery, irregular treatment techniques, intraoperative complications, and management principles to promote the standardized application of mechanical suture technique. We also explain the shortcomings of the technique in order to promote the further improvement and perfection.

  • Quality control standard and evaluation of lung transplantation

    The quality control of lung transplantation involves many aspects, such as team building, selection of recipients, preoperative diagnosis and evaluation of recipients, maintenance of brain-dead donors, evaluation and acquisition of donors, surgical operation, postoperative management and postoperative follow-up. Precision management is the core concept of operation quality control. Only by normalizing the operation quality control of lung transplantation to provide basic guarantee for multi-team cooperation and development of lung transplantation management in the future, building a complete lung transplantation database to excavate data resources and improve the quality of transplantation, and comprehensively building a Chinese lung transplantation quality control system with multi-team participation and cooperation, can we improve the overall level of surgical diagnosis and treatment of lung transplantation in China.

  • The management of day surgery in minimally invasive surgery for 517 patients with early-stage lung cancer by enhanced recovery after surgery

    ObjectiveTo evaluate the safety and effect of day surgery in minimally invasive surgical treatment of early-stage lung cancer by enhanced recovery after surgery (ERAS).MethodsWe included the patients discharged from the day surgery ward of thoracic surgery after surgery in Shanghai Pulmonary Hospital between June and November 2019. We retrospectively analyzed surgical indications of day surgery, management and perioperative medical history of the patients. A total of 517 patients were included, with 156 male and 361 female patients aged 46.4±10.9 years. A total of 45 patients underwent single port VATS segmentectomy and 472 patients underwent single port VATS wedge resection.ResultsThe average operation duration was 33.7±18.5 min. The average intraoperative blood loss was 28.5±21.4 mL. There was no intraoperative blood transfusion or conversion to thoracotomy. Postoperative pain score was 2.1±0.2. The average hospitalization was 1.94±0.89 days. The total hospitalization cost of the patients was 34686.51±6228.09 Yuan, which was 29.93% lower than the same surgery methods in the general ward. A percentage of 98.2% patients were satisfied or very satisfied in the patient satisfaction survey.ConclusionDay surgery and ERAS are effective and safe in minimally invasive surgery of early-stage lung cancer. It can also speed up the postoperative recovery of patients, improve the occupancy efficiency of hospital beds and save the medical cost.

  • Interpretation of updated NCCN clinical practice guidelines for lung cancer screening (version 2. 2022)

    Lung cancer is the most common cancer and the leading cause of cancer-related death in China. Early screening of lung cancer proves to be effective in improving its prognosis. The National Comprehensive Cancer Network (NCCN) has updated and released version 2, 2022 NCCN clinical practice guidelines for lung cancer screening in July, 2022. Based on high-quality clinical evidence and the latest research progress, the guidelines have developed and updated criteria for lung cancer screening which have been widely recognized by clinicians around the world. Compared with Chinese lung cancer screening guidelines, this article will interpret the updated content of the brand new 2022 NCCN screening guidelines, providing some reference for the current lung cancer screening practice in our country.
